Overview and History of Matrixdock Gold (XAUM)

Matrixdock Gold (XAUM) represents a digital form of gold ownership, leveraging blockchain technology to provide investors with a convenient and accessible way to invest in gold. Each XAUM token represents a fractional ownership of physical gold held in secure vaults. This tokenization process aims to bridge the gap between traditional precious metal investments and the burgeoning digital asset space.

Unlike traditional methods of buying and storing gold, XAUM streamlines the process, eliminating the need for physical storage, insurance, and logistical complexities. Matrixdock facilitates the creation and management of these tokens, ensuring the underlying gold reserves are securely maintained and regularly audited. The project strives to offer a transparent and reliable gold-backed digital asset.

XAUM Tokenomics: Supply and Distribution

The supply of XAUM tokens is directly linked to the amount of physical gold held in custody. As more gold is added to the vault, more XAUM tokens are minted, and vice versa. This ensures that each token remains backed by a specific quantity of gold. This mechanism creates a transparent and verifiable link between the digital asset and the underlying physical asset.

While the specific distribution mechanism can vary, generally, XAUM tokens are available for purchase on cryptocurrency exchanges and through authorized dealers. The initial distribution might involve a private sale or an initial exchange offering (IEO) to raise capital and bootstrap liquidity. The circulating supply will fluctuate based on demand and the amount of gold held in reserve.

Technology and Blockchain Infrastructure

XAUM leverages blockchain technology, commonly Ethereum, to record ownership and facilitate transactions. The ERC-20 standard, for example, provides a well-established framework for creating and managing the tokens. Blockchain's inherent security and immutability ensure that all transactions are transparent and tamper-proof.

Smart contracts are integral to the XAUM ecosystem. These self-executing contracts automate key processes, such as minting and burning tokens based on gold reserves. This automation reduces the risk of human error and ensures the integrity of the system. The use of blockchain also provides a level of transparency and auditability that is not possible with traditional gold investments.

Use Cases and Ecosystem of XAUM

XAUM primarily serves as a digital store of value, offering investors an alternative to traditional gold investments. It can be used for diversification within a portfolio, hedging against inflation, or simply as a safe haven asset during times of economic uncertainty. The tokenized nature of XAUM makes it more accessible and divisible than physical gold, allowing investors to hold even small fractions of a gold bar.

  • Diversification: XAUM can be integrated into diversified investment portfolios.
  • Inflation Hedge: Gold is often seen as a hedge against inflation, and XAUM provides a digital way to access this.
  • Safe Haven Asset: During economic downturns, investors often flock to gold as a safe haven, making XAUM a potential option.
  • Digital Payments: Potentially used in the future for payments and transactions.

FAQ
Is XAUM backed by physical gold?

Yes, each XAUM token is reportedly backed by a fractional ownership of physical gold held in secure vaults. Regular audits are typically conducted to verify the gold reserves.

How is the gold custody managed?

The gold backing XAUM is usually held in secure, professional vaults. These vaults are typically insured and subject to independent audits to ensure the safety and integrity of the gold reserves.

Where can I buy and sell XAUM?

XAUM tokens are typically available for purchase and sale on various cryptocurrency exchanges that support the trading of ERC-20 tokens. Check with the Matrixdock platform for a list of supported exchanges.

What are the fees associated with XAUM?

Fees may include transaction fees on the blockchain network, custody fees for the gold storage, and potentially trading fees on the exchanges where XAUM is listed. Refer to the specific exchange or platform for detailed fee information.

Is XAUM a regulated asset?

The regulatory status of XAUM can vary depending on the jurisdiction. It's essential to check with legal and financial advisors to understand the specific regulations in your region.

What are the risks of investing in XAUM?

Risks include market volatility, regulatory uncertainty, counterparty risk associated with the custodian, and the potential for technical issues with the blockchain network. As with any investment, it's important to conduct thorough research and understand the risks involved before investing in XAUM.
